Things to Do around Montceaux-Lès-Provins

Montceaux-Lès-Provins is a commune located within the greater Provins region in Seine-et-Marne, Île-de-France. This area is characterized by its picturesque Briard countryside, offering a mix of rural landscapes and well-paved surfaces ideal for outdoor pursuits. The terrain features gentle rolling hills and scenic routes, making it suitable for several sports like road cycling. Its setting provides a tranquil environment for exploring the natural beauty of the region.

What are the notable landmarks or natural features near Montceaux-Lès-Provins?

Montceaux-Lès-Provins is situated near the UNESCO World Heritage site of Provins, known for its medieval architecture and ramparts. Other nearby attractions include the Château du Vivier with its 7-hectare park and the Jardin Garnier. The Voulzie River also contributes to the scenic beauty of the region.
